diff --git a/zh-cn/application-dev/reference/apis-core-file-kit/js-apis-userFileManager-sys.md b/zh-cn/application-dev/reference/apis-core-file-kit/js-apis-userFileManager-sys.md index bcea2a1850267d2661f33bbf2ecf8c3e05c9b692..a9bae51d7cd5b6526cbff99fa5e10a55bfc2bf92 100644 --- a/zh-cn/application-dev/reference/apis-core-file-kit/js-apis-userFileManager-sys.md +++ b/zh-cn/application-dev/reference/apis-core-file-kit/js-apis-userFileManager-sys.md @@ -1922,7 +1922,7 @@ async function example(mgr: userFileManager.UserFileManager) { | ------------------------- | ------------------------ | ---- | ---- | ------------------------------------------------------ | | uri | string | 是 | 否 | 媒体文件资源uri(如:file://media/Photo/1/IMG_datetime_0001/displayName.jpg),详情参见用户文件uri介绍中的[媒体文件uri](../../file-management/user-file-uri-intro.md#媒体文件uri)。 | | fileType | [FileType](#filetype) | 是 | 否 | 媒体文件类型。 | -| displayName | string | 是 | 是 | 显示文件名,包含后缀名。 | +| displayName | string | 否 | 否 | 显示文件名,包含后缀名。 | ### get @@ -3454,14 +3454,15 @@ async function example(mgr: userFileManager.UserFileManager) { **系统能力**:SystemCapability.FileManagement.UserFileManager.Core -| 名称 | 类型 | 只读 | 可写 | 说明 | +| 名称 | 类型 | 只读 | 可选 | 说明 | | ------------ | ------ | ---- | ---- | ------- | | albumType10+ | [AlbumType]( #albumtype10) | 是 | 否 | 相册类型。 | | albumSubType10+ | [AlbumSubType]( #albumsubtype10) | 是 | 否 | 相册子类型。 | -| albumName | string | 是 | 用户相册可写,预置相册不可写 | 相册名称。 | +| albumName | string | 否 | 否 | 相册名称。
**说明:** 用户相册可写,预置相册不可写。 | | albumUri | string | 是 | 否 | 相册Uri。 | +| dateModified | number | 是 | 否 | 相册的修改时间。 | | count | number | 是 | 否 | 相册中文件数量。 | -| coverUri | string | 是 | 用户相册可写,预置相册不可写 | 封面文件Uri。 | +| coverUri | string | 否 | 否 | 封面文件Uri。
**说明:** 用户相册可写,预置相册不可写。 | ### getPhotoAssets @@ -4152,11 +4153,11 @@ async function example(mgr: userFileManager.UserFileManager) { | 名称 | 类型 | 只读 | 可写 | 说明 | | ------------ | ------ | ---- | ---- | ------- | -| albumName | string | 是 | 是 | 相册名称。 | +| albumName | string | 否 | 否 | 相册名称。 | | albumUri | string | 是 | 否 | 相册Uri。 | | dateModified | number | 是 | 否 | 修改日期。 | | count | number | 是 | 否 | 相册中文件数量。 | -| coverUri | string | 是 | 否 | 封面文件Uri。 | +| coverUri | string | 否 | 否 | 封面文件Uri。 | ### getPhotoAssets @@ -4473,7 +4474,7 @@ async function example(mgr: userFileManager.UserFileManager) { **系统能力**:SystemCapability.FileManagement.UserFileManager.Core -| 名称 | 类型 | 只读 | 可写 | 说明 | +| 名称 | 类型 | 只读 | 可选 | 说明 | | ----- | ---- | ---- | ---- | ---- | | number | number | 是 | 是 | number类型。 | | string | string | 是 | 是 | string类型。| @@ -4485,14 +4486,14 @@ async function example(mgr: userFileManager.UserFileManager) { **系统能力**:SystemCapability.FileManagement.UserFileManager.Core -| 名称 | 类型 | 只读 | 可写 | 说明 | -| ----- | ---- | ---- | ---- | ---- | -| deviceChange | string | 是 | 是 | 设备。 | -| albumChange | string | 是 | 是 | 相册。 | -| imageChange | string | 是 | 是 | 图片。 | -| audioChange | string | 是 | 是 | 音频。 | -| videoChange | string | 是 | 是 | 视频。 | -| remoteFileChange | string | 是 | 是 | 远程文件。 | +| 名称 | 类型 | 必填 | 说明 | +| -------- | ------------------------- | ---- | ----- | +| deviceChange | string | 是 | 设备。 | +| albumChange | string | 是 | 相册。 | +| imageChange | string | 是 | 图片。 | +| audioChange | string | 是 | 音频。 | +| videoChange | string | 是 | 视频。 | +| remoteFileChange | string | 是 | 远程文件。 | ## PeerInfo @@ -4500,7 +4501,7 @@ async function example(mgr: userFileManager.UserFileManager) { **系统能力**:SystemCapability.FileManagement.UserFileManager.DistributedCore -| 名称 | 类型 | 只读 | 可写 | 说明 | +| 名称 | 类型 | 只读 | 可选 | 说明 | | ---------- | -------------------------- | ---- | ---- | ---------------- | | deviceName | string | 是 | 否 | 注册设备的名称。 | | networkId | string | 是 | 否 | 注册设备的网络ID。 | @@ -4658,10 +4659,10 @@ async function example(mgr: userFileManager.UserFileManager) { **系统能力**:SystemCapability.FileManagement.UserFileManager.Core -| 名称 | 类型 | 只读 | 可写 | 说明 | +| 名称 | 类型 | 只读 | 可选 | 说明 | | ---------------------- | ------------------- | ---- |---- | ------------------------------------------------ | -| fetchColumns | Array<string> | 是 | 是 | 检索条件,指定列名查询,如果该参数为空时默认查询uri、name、fileType(具体字段名称以检索对象定义为准)且使用[get](#get)接口去获取当前对象的其他属性时将会报错。示例:
fetchColumns: ['uri', 'title']。 | -| predicates | [dataSharePredicates.DataSharePredicates](../apis-arkdata/js-apis-data-dataSharePredicates-sys.md) | 是 | 是 | 谓词查询,显示过滤条件。 | +| fetchColumns | Array<string> | 否 | 否 | 检索条件,指定列名查询,如果该参数为空时默认查询uri、name、fileType(具体字段名称以检索对象定义为准)且使用[get](#get)接口去获取当前对象的其他属性时将会报错。示例:
fetchColumns: ['uri', 'title']。 | +| predicates | [dataSharePredicates.DataSharePredicates](../apis-arkdata/js-apis-data-dataSharePredicates-sys.md) | 否 | 否 | 谓词查询,显示过滤条件。 | ## AlbumFetchOptions @@ -4669,9 +4670,9 @@ async function example(mgr: userFileManager.UserFileManager) { **系统能力**:SystemCapability.FileManagement.UserFileManager.Core -| 名称 | 类型 | 只读 | 可写 | 说明 | +| 名称 | 类型 | 只读 | 可选 | 说明 | | ---------------------- | ------------------- | ---- |---- | ------------------------------------------------ | -| predicates | [dataSharePredicates.DataSharePredicates](../apis-arkdata/js-apis-data-dataSharePredicates-sys.md) | 是 | 是 | 谓词查询,显示过滤条件。 | +| predicates | [dataSharePredicates.DataSharePredicates](../apis-arkdata/js-apis-data-dataSharePredicates-sys.md) | 否 | 否 | 谓词查询,显示过滤条件。 | ## ChangeData10+ @@ -4681,9 +4682,9 @@ async function example(mgr: userFileManager.UserFileManager) { | 名称 | 类型 | 只读 | 可写 | 说明 | | ------- | --------------------------- | ---- | ---- | ------------------------------------------------------------ | -| type | [NotifyType](#notifytype10) | 是 | 否 | ChangeData的通知类型。 | -| uris | Array<string> | 是 | 否 | 相同[NotifyType](#notifytype10)的所有uri,可以是FileAsset或Album。 | -| subUris | Array<string> | 是 | 否 | 相册中变动文件的uri数组。可能为undefined,使用前需要检查是否为undefined。| +| type | [NotifyType](#notifytype10) | 否 | 否 | ChangeData的通知类型。 | +| uris | Array<string> | 否 | 否 | 相同[NotifyType](#notifytype10)的所有uri,可以是FileAsset或Album。 | +| subUris | Array<string> | 否 | 否 | 相册中变动文件的uri数组。可能为undefined,使用前需要检查是否为undefined。| ## NotifyType10+